Re: Autocar articles featuring the Coupé 20vT - 09/04/2009 13:36

Are the 50-70mph times in the last article correct? The Fiat manages 6.2 seconds compared to the 9.4 and 9.8 for the Mistubishi and Nissan, which seems phenomenally quicker?

Actually just spotted the torque figures, the Coupe produces more torque than the other two at much lower RPM. However, surely peak torque on the 20VT isn't at 2500RPM? Mines only just starting to spool up around then (stock turbo), but it's pulling like a train by about 3000RPM.

Posted By: Trappy

Re: Autocar articles featuring the Coupé 20vT - 13/04/2009 17:44

Originally Posted By: k9huff
Are the 50-70mph times in the last article correct? The Fiat manages 6.2 seconds compared to the 9.4 and 9.8 for the Mistubishi and Nissan, which seems phenomenally quicker?

Actually just spotted the torque figures, the Coupe produces more torque than the other two at much lower RPM. However, surely peak torque on the 20VT isn't at 2500RPM? Mines only just starting to spool up around then (stock turbo), but it's pulling like a train by about 3000RPM.


I've often thought this too. I don't think I've ever seen a 20vT make peak torque at 2,500rpm. In fact my car running a GTiR @ 1.35bar makes only 168.6lbs/ft at 2,500rpms. 228 sounds a little optimistic but that test car ust have to put in that stonking 6.2s. The other two can't be compared here though to be fair. The FTO is a rev monster like a vtec and the 200 engine is a much revvier engine to ours.

My car still doesn't do the 50-70mph in top in 6.2 secs.
Posted By: Anonymous

Re: Autocar articles featuring the Coupé 20vT - 06/05/2009 22:20

Would it be possible for Fiat to have supplied Autocar with a fettled up model for their road test. Best 50-70 time in fifth gear I can manage in my bog std 20VT is around 7.0 seconds, 6.8 on a slight downhill incline. Rev limiter deffo higher on the test car because it was set to 7000rpm. Std cars apparently limited to 6800rpm confused

Agree with Trappy. I don't see how peak Torque on a STd 20VT can be anything lower than somewhere between 3 and 3.5k revs based on driving experience.
